Transaction 1896707c3b57c4ca054b931dfa931ccb15f4345e372fba0708c9cc369b0383bd

1 Input
2 Outputs
  • 1896707c3b57c4ca054b931dfa931ccb15f4345e372fba0708c9cc369b0383bd:0
  • value  65649978
    address  129ovmuVifEBqHsofhpN6kmsjXANbmp2iU
  • 1896707c3b57c4ca054b931dfa931ccb15f4345e372fba0708c9cc369b0383bd:1
  • value  26462286
    address  3667SfdwotKuFTfoNYomDuzpoWJHY52MB1